Tennessee woman arrested in Baxter County for forging paperwork to take property from her aunt

Summary by KTLO LLC
A woman from Tennessee has been arrested in Baxter County for forging paperwork to take property from her aunt. The woman, 30-year-old Cheyenne Summer Schubert of Crossville, turned herself in at the Baxter County Sheriff’s Office Monday morning. According to the probable cause affidavit from the Baxter County Sheriff’s Office, a woman reported she had been deeded property by a family member which was filed in 2023.
